How much do car shuttle j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 1, 2026, the average hourly pay for car shuttle in the United States is $18.12,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$20.19 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a car shuttle?

Car shuttle drivers are professionals responsible for transporting vehicles from one location to another. They often work for car rental companies, dealerships, or logistics firms, moving cars between branches, to and from maintenance facilities, or delivering vehicles to customers. The job may involve driving a variety of vehicles, keeping records of trips, and ensuring the safe and timely delivery of cars. Car shuttle drivers must have a valid driver's license, a clean driving record, and good knowledge of local routes. Attention to detail and customer service skills are also important in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a car shuttle driver?

To thrive as a Car Shuttle driver, you need a valid driver's license, a clean driving record, and familiarity with basic vehicle operation and safety procedures. Experience with GPS navigation systems, vehicle inspection checklists, and occasionally inventory management software is often required. Excellent time management, attention to detail, and strong communication skills help ensure efficient vehicle transfers and positive customer interactions. These skills are crucial to maintain safety, punctuality, and customer satisfaction in a role that often operates under tight schedules.

What are some common challenges faced by car shuttle drivers, and how can they be managed effectively?

Car Shuttle drivers often face challenges such as navigating tight schedules, handling multiple vehicle pickups or drop-offs in busy environments, and ensuring each vehicle is inspected for damage before and after transit. Effective time management and clear communication with dispatchers and team members are crucial to staying on track. Additionally, attention to detail during vehicle inspections helps prevent misunderstandings and ensures customer satisfaction.

Is car shuttle driving a stressful job?

Car shuttle driving can be physically demanding and requires attention to safety and traffic rules, which may contribute to stress levels. The job often involves working in outdoor environments and managing tight schedules, but stress varies depending on individual experience and work conditions.

What kind of license do you need to drive a car shuttle?

To work as a car shuttle driver, you typically need a valid driver's license appropriate for the vehicle type, often a standard or commercial driver's license (CDL) if operating larger or specialized vehicles. Additional certifications or training may be required depending on the employer and vehicle size, and a clean driving record is usually necessary.
